The rig, starting life from the factory as:

2021 Freedom, Bright White
Hard top
All Weather mats
Hard Top Liner
Grab Handles
Door Sills

Packages:
Tech group
Aux Switch
Conv Group
Cold Weather Group
8.4 UConect
Max Tow Package
Selec-Trac

Some of the stuff wasn't wanted but was off the lot from the dealer. Over all this was the build I wanted with selec-trac, max tow, cold weather group, led lighting and 8.4 as the main items.

End goal is a good mild off road, camping, exploring, mid size tow vehicle.

Short term plans, parts ordered:
1.5 Teraflex spacer front, 3/4" daystar rear w new mopar LCA.
285/75/r17 Toyo OC AT III's
Factory rims to satin black powder coat (this was way less than buying new rims).
Front satin black grill.
De-badge the Freedom stuff

Long term plans, performance pending:
Magnuson SC kit, after first oil change this will be installed.
Sumo Springs rear
Fox shocks


This will be paired with a 16' Mirage Hardcore toy hauler, that's currently being built. GVWR 7000, dry apx 4k.

First weekend and first 400 miles.

My dealer was great, highly recommend Findlay in Post Falls ID. Matt my sales guy and Cam the manager were top.

Ok, off the lot, I headed to Walmart. I forethought every thing... so I thought. I ordered two real nice USB cables for my new truck and well clicked the wrong ones, got Android cables not iPhone. Bleh. Need a cable, I got a very nice camo blue one :puke:

Steering was tight, but it wandered. After Walmart got on I90 and it wandered a bunch. Drove abought 50 miles then decided to stop.

The tires has 43psi in them, as I read here that can cause handling issues Dropped them all down to 37 and the wander was all but gone. Much better.

Steering was tight, even as one member noted play, I wiggle my steering wheel the truck wiggles also. Good as any other truck I have had.

Seats, firm but up right I could not figure out how to lay the seat back. Took me a bit and another stop to find the "handle" :facepalm:. Much better.

I have the 4.10's and in stock trim the motor is peppy, revs nice, passing was absolutely no issue at all. Very impressed actually. I'm sure it will change with bigger tires and weight added.

The 8.4" Uconnect is great. I really am happy I opted for it over the 7. The Off-road pages are cool. The Carplay is great. Screen is customizable. Back up camera, wow thing is spectacular. By far the best back up camera I have had.

Handling, it's no BMW X5 or a sports car. It's defiantly soft shocked/sprung? Going over RR tracks is a breeze. Never felt unsettled in a corner but it defiantly liked to be set up for it. I drove a lot of 2 lane back country roads on my way back. I could easily take 50 mph turns at 65 mph. Rig felt planted, comfortable, with no pull left or right.

Speed, it's noisy compared to my 2018 Chevy Equinox, but on par with my 2019 Cherokee (which is an under powered pos that revs to the moon just to get out of it's own way, work car). When I say noisy I do not mean loud, but it's not as quiet and dose not have the aero of the other rigs. My rig has the factory head liner, I'm not sure how much that has to play. I had music set to vol 10 most of the time and could easily have phone calls at 70 mph.

I topped out at 95 once passing some traffic, truck again planted, compliant and happy to go there. Factory cut off is 97 mph? not sure.

Happy to report, no rock chips, but bugs galore. Farm country and a flat window = splatter.

Mileage, 20.2 mpg for the trip. Got better as time went on. I noted the rage calculator did not work right till the second fill up apx 300 miles in. Then it read right. I'm assuming it was learning what the real mpg was or there is a min average it needs.

Auto start stop is easy to turn off just set ac to Low. :idea:

Tazer installed, I highly recommend getting the extended harness for later access.

Tire size set, I measured and set to the actual measurements and Speedo was off a little bought 1.25 mph low. Adj up to 33.8ā€ and am now as spot on as can get vs gps.

285/75r17 on factory wheels Toyo Open Country AT III. 4.10 gearing 75 mph in 8th right at 2100ish rpm.
